Feminine declension scheme:
This is the Feminine declension of the word Veśanī following the rules for -ī.
feminine ī-stem declension for 'Veśanī'
single | dual | plural | |
---|---|---|---|
nominative. | veśanī | veśanyau | veśanyaḥ |
accusative. | veśanīm | veśanyau | veśanīḥ |
instrumental. | veśanyā | veśanībhyām | veśanībhiḥ |
dative. | veśanyai | veśanībhyām | veśanībhyaḥ |
ablative. | veśanyāḥ | veśanībhyām | veśanībhyaḥ |
genitive. | veśanyāḥ | veśanyoḥ | veśanīnām |
locative. | veśanyām | veśanyoḥ | veśanīṣu |
vocative. | veśani | veśanyau | veśanyaḥ |
